This evening (November 5, 2024) Elephant Hospital page The Thai Elephant Conservation Center, Lampang province, updates the condition of Nong Kanya. Lost wild elephant calf from Bueng Kan who moved to learn to live with elephants and have the opportunity to drink elephant milk from Mae Rab A Phat Pang Chang Chiang Mai Province Ultimo Nong Kanya Sick, from the examination of the blood is infected with the elephant virus Today’s general symptoms Nong Kanya feels lethargic, can eat less, has no fever, her stools are mucous, rather liquid and have a bad smell. He only peed once after Kanya. I haven’t peed since I was admitted to Elephant Hospital.
Hospital page administrator Chang also informed that Nong Kanya has clearer symptoms of EEHV virus disease, namely that her face is more swollen. and found a blood stain on his tongue From his younger brother’s symptoms Now the doctor is considering adding stem cell treatment. It will be an alternative treatment in addition to the main treatment. Stem cells have the following effects:
Helps reduce inflammation throughout the body
It has antiviral properties
It helps maintain balance and strengthen new blood vessel cells. This is the main organ damaged by this disease.
Thanks to Mrs. Kanchana Silpa-archa who also supported the cost of stem cell treatment this time.
On the other hand, Kanchana Silpa-archa posted a message via personal Facebook that Tonight, 100 million units of stem cells will be sent from Bangkok to Lampang, where doctors will start injecting Nong Kanya tomorrow (6 Nov 24).
